📅  最后修改于: 2023-12-03 14:57:22.048000             🧑  作者: Mango
Python是一门高级编程语言,提供了强大的工具来操作各种数据类型,包括列表。在编写Python脚本时,我们经常需要操作列表,而规范化列表则是一个很好的实践。
规范化列表是指,在编写Python脚本时,我们使用一致的命名约定、格式和注释来定义和使用列表。这样做可以使我们的代码更加可读、易于维护和重用。
以下是规范化列表的示例:
# 定义一个规范化的列表
fruits = [
"apple", # 苹果
"banana", # 香蕉
"orange", # 橙子
]
# 打印规范化的列表
print("我喜欢的水果:")
for fruit in fruits:
print(fruit)
要规范化列表,我们需要遵循以下几个步骤:
在定义列表变量时,应使用相同的命名约定。通常使用小写字母和下划线组成的单词,例如:fruit_list
。如果变量名由多个单词组成,则可以使用蛇形命名法。
以下是一些示例:
# 使用蛇形命名法定义规范化的列表
first_name_list = [
"Alice",
"Bob",
"Charlie",
]
last_name_list = [
"Smith",
"Johnson",
"Williams",
]
在定义列表时,应使用一致的格式。以下是一些示例:
# 紧凑的格式
fruits = ["apple", "banana", "orange"]
# 每个元素占一行的格式
fruits = [
"apple",
"banana",
"orange",
]
# 每个元素占一行的格式,使用缩进
fruits = [
"apple",
"banana",
"orange",
]
# 使用分隔符的格式
fruits = "apple, banana, orange".split(", ")
建议使用每个元素占一行的格式,因为这样可以更清楚地看到列表的内容,也便于添加和删除元素。
在定义列表时,应提供注释来说明列表的含义。以下是一些示例:
# 定义包含方法名称的列表,用于动态调用
method_names = [
"get",
"post",
"put",
"delete",
]
# 定义包含配置参数的列表
config_options = [
"--username",
"--password",
"--host",
"--port",
]
注释应简短明了,并且足以说明列表的用途。
规范化列表可以提高Python代码的可读性、可维护性和可重用性。在定义列表时,应使用一致的命名约定、格式和注释。